What Is a Tip (Gratuity)?
A tip, or gratuity, is a sum of money given to service workers in addition to the basic price of a service. It is usually expressed as a percentage of the total bill. For instance, a tip of 6% means you are giving 6 cents for every dollar spent.

What is 6% of a $560 bill?
To calculate 6% of a $560 bill, multiply 560 by 0.06, which equals $33.60. This is the tip amount.

Are tips taxed?
Yes, tips are considered taxable income by the IRS and must be reported by the service worker. It is important for service staff to keep track of their tips for tax purposes.
